The microRNA-29 family (miRNA-29s) has three mature members, miR-29a, miR-29b and miR-29c, which have been implicated in the regulation of the pathogenesis of Alzheimer׳s disease (AD). The miR-29 family members exhibit differential regulation in various diseases and different subcellular distribution. Recently, BACE1 expression was shown to be regulated by microRNAs, small endogenous RNA molecules that regulate protein expression through sequence-specific interaction with messenger RNA. Here, we showed that microRNA-29c (miR-29c), a miRNA that is enriched in the brain and highly expressed in the APPswe/PSΔE9 mouse lowers BACE1 protein in vitro and in transgenic miR-29c mice.
